The economy of Campbell, Goshen, Platte, Johnson, Washakie, Weston, Crook & Niobrara Counties PUMA, WY employs 52,170 people. The economy of Campbell, Goshen, Platte, Johnson, Washakie, Weston, Crook & Niobrara Counties PUMA, WY is specialized in Management of Companies & Enterprises; Mining, Quarrying, Oil, Gas Extraction; and Agriculture, Forestry, Fishing, Hunting, which employ respectively 4.72; 1.83; and 1.53 times more people than what would be expected in a location of this size. The largest industries in Campbell, Goshen, Platte, Johnson, Washakie, Weston, Crook & Niobrara Counties PUMA, WY are Mining, Quarrying, Oil, Gas Extraction (8,623), Educational Services (5,320), and Healthcare & Social Assistance (5,224), and the highest paying industries are Utilities ($74,886), Mining, Quarrying, Oil, Gas Extraction ($71,914), and Transportation & Warehousing ($48,415).
Median household income in Campbell, Goshen, Platte, Johnson, Washakie, Weston, Crook & Niobrara Counties PUMA, WY is $61,658. Males in Campbell, Goshen, Platte, Johnson, Washakie, Weston, Crook & Niobrara Counties PUMA, WY have an average income that is 1.57 times higher than the average income of females, which is $41,792. The income inequality of Campbell, Goshen, Platte, Johnson, Washakie, Weston, Crook & Niobrara Counties PUMA, WY (measured using the Gini index) is 0.469 which is lower than the national average.

Campbell, Goshen, Platte, Johnson, Washakie, Weston, Crook & Niobrara Counties PUMA, WY is home to a population of 104,639 people, from which 98.2% are citizens. The ethnic composition of the population of Campbell, Goshen, Platte, Johnson, Washakie, Weston, Crook & Niobrara Counties PUMA, WY is composed of 92,692 White residents (88.6%), 7,861 Hispanic residents (7.51%), 1,839 Two+ residents (1.76%), 978 Native residents (0.93%), and 747 Asian residents (0.71%). The most common foreign languages in Campbell, Goshen, Platte, Johnson, Washakie, Weston, Crook & Niobrara Counties PUMA, WY are Spanish (4,144 speakers), German (312 speakers), and French (166 speakers), but compared to other places, Campbell, Goshen, Platte, Johnson, Washakie, Weston, Crook & Niobrara Counties PUMA, WY has a relative high number of Thai (56 speakers), Other Pacific Island (149 speakers), and German (312 speakers).
